Gas production engineers develop methods to optimise the extraction and production of gas for energy and utilities. They design systems for gas production, supervise production operations and develop improvements on existing systems.

How these figures were compiled

Coverage is the share of the target role’s weighted skill requirement a gas production engineer already meets, counting required skills in full and supplementary ones at 0.35.
